Prosecutor Calls for DNA From Families to Identify Two Unmatched Male Profiles in Jurado Case

The testing window runs through February 28 at the MPA in San Salvador de Jujuy to finalize evidence before seeking trial.

  • Investigators say two unidentified male genetic profiles were recovered from the suspect’s home, while five profiles already match named victims.
  • Relatives of missing men are asked to give samples on business days from 8:00 to 13:00 at Urquiza 462, with collection open through February 28.
  • Matías Jurado stands accused of five counts of aggravated homicide under charges of ensañamiento, alevosía y placer, which carry the maximum penalty.
  • Preliminary testing on evidence taken from the residence was positive for blood, and forensic genetics forms the backbone of the prosecution’s case.
  • Jurado remains in preventive detention at the Gorriti unit until at least April 4, a psychiatric evaluation deemed him criminally responsible, and he continues to deny involvement.
